Subject: Re: x86_64: Make sparsemem/vmemmap the default memory model

On Nov 12, 2007 7:42 PM, Christoph Lameter <clameter@....com> wrote:
> Ok here is the patch to remove DISCONTIG and FLATMEM
>
> x86_64: Make sparsemem/vmemmap the default memory model
>
> Use sparsemem as the only memory model for UP, SMP and NUMA.
> Measurements indicate that DISCONTIGMEM has a higher overhead
> than sparsemem. And FLATMEMs benefits are minimal. So I think its
> best to simply standardize on sparsemem.
>
> Results of page allocator tests (test can be had via git from slab git
> tree branch tests)
>
> Measurements in cycle counts. 1000 allocations were performed and then the
> average cycle count was calculated.
>
> Order   FlatMem Discontig       SparseMem
> 0         639     665             641
> 1         567     647             593
> 2         679     774             692
> 3         763     967             781
> 4         961    1501             962
> 5        1356    2344            1392
> 6        2224    3982            2336
> 7        4869    7225            5074
> 8       12500   14048           12732
> 9       27926   28223           28165
> 10      58578   58714           58682

Discontig obviously needs to die. However, FlatMem is consistently
faster, averaging about 2.1% better overall for your numbers above. Is
the page allocator not, erm, a fast path, where that matters?

Order	Flat	Sparse	% diff
0	639	641	0.3
1	567	593	4.4
2	679	692	1.9
3	763	781	2.3
4	961	962	0.1
5	1356	1392	2.6
6	2224	2336	4.8
7	4869	5074	4.0
8	12500	12732	1.8
9	27926	28165	0.8
10	58578	58682	0.2
